Summary
General Practice Assistants ("GPA"s), support the smooth running of clinics by performing more routine administration and clinical tasks on behalf of the GP, freeing up their time to focus on the patient This is an exciting role within a Primary Care setting working as part of the Waterside PCN team, where you will be using your skills to support and complement our existing team of clinicians, providing and monitoring patient centred care, across the patient population. Waterside PCN is an expanding, forwarding thinking primary care network based on the Waterside in Hampshire. With 46,000 registered patients across 5 sites we are a busy network, yet all our teams both clinical and admin are supportive, friendly and work closely together to ensure excellent service provision to our patients. While this is a PCN wide role, you will primarily be supporting the Red and Green Practice. Main duties of the job / Key Responsibilities: Arranging appointments, referrals, tests and follow up appointments of patients Completing simple clinical observations /investigations as directed locally, such as dipstick urine, taking blood pressure, ECG, phlebotomy Supporting the GP with immunisations/wound care Preparing patients prior to going in to see the GP, taking a brief history and basic readings in readiness for the GP appointment Completing basic (non-opinion) forms and core elements of some forms for the GP to approve and sign such as insurance forms, mortgage, benefits agency forms etc Explaining treatment procedures to patients Helping the GP liaise with outside agencies e.g. getting an on call doctor on the phone to ask advice or arrange admission while the GP can continue with their consultation(s) Sorting clinical post and prioritising for the GP. Signposting some post to other members of staff Extracting information from clinical letters that needs coding; adding this to patient notes. Supporting with QOF reviews.
